  • MINERAL PROCESSING - MILLING - United Diversity

    2020.12.4  The process can be wet or dry but is more commonly carried out wet. Maximum rod length is about 6 to 7 metres, otherwise there is a risk of the rods bowing. The drum diameter is limited to 0.6 or 0.7 times the length of the mill. Characteristics Rod mills are used for grinding hard minerals. This type of mill is usually used as the first stage

  • Addition of pebbles to a ball-mill to improve grinding

    2018.11.1  Milling is the most expensive process in the mineral processing stage, with energy and grinding media (steel) consumption being the most expensive cost items. ... The ball-mills in SABC circuits are operated at a relatively high speed (70–78% of critical speed), with large balls (50 mm to 80 mm), to cope with a coarse feed (a transfer size ...

  • Development of ore sorting and its impact on mineral processing ...

    2014.10.15  The energy costs required to refine metal values contained in ore to concentrates constitute the majority of the cost to produce metals. On average across the mining industry, 44% of the total electricity consumption is dedicated to crushing and milling activities (Fig. 1).Size reduction operations, nearly 150 × 10 9 kW h, are the largest

  • Digital Solutions to Evaluate Ball Mill Circuit

    2023.2.11  The closed ball milling circuit is a key part of many minerals processing operations. Recirculating load is the fraction of mass flowing through the mill divided by the feed throughput, and this has been found to be a significant consideration in mill circuit performance, and thus the economics of the operation.
